In plain English

Funds the National Center for Construction Safety and Health to research and promote workplace safety standards in the construction industry.

Sub-sectors
public-healthoccupational-safetyconstruction-industry
Why this matters

Construction is a high-injury industry; this center develops evidence-based safety practices reducing worker fatalities and healthcare costs.
